Insider Tips for the Best Texture and Flavor in Each Bite

  • Opt for smooth, creamy peanut butter for a consistent texture and better cookie structure.
  • Chill the dough for 15-20 minutes before rolling to prevent sticky hands and easier shaping.
  • Use a fork dipped in granulated sugar when creating crisscross patterns to prevent sticking.
  • For gluten-free version, ensure all ingredients are certified gluten-free, especially baking soda.
  • Store c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 5 days to maintain freshness.

How to Store Peanut Butter Cookies for Lasting Freshness

  • Store leftover c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 5 days, keeping them soft and fresh.
  • Separate layers with parchment paper to prevent sticking and maintain their delicate texture.
  • Freeze baked cookies in a freezer-safe container for up to 3 months, wrapping each cookie individually in plastic wrap first.
  • Reheat frozen or refrigerated cookies by microwaving for 10-15 seconds or letting them sit at room temperature for 15-20 minutes to restore their original softness.

FAQs

  • Can I use natural or organic peanut butter?

Yes, you can use natural or organic peanut butter, but make sure it’s well-stirred and not too runny. Separated or oily peanut butter might affect the cookie’s texture.

  • How do I prevent the cookies from crumbling?

Mix the ingredients thoroughly and don’t overbake. Let the cookies cool completely on the baking sheet before transferring to prevent cracking.

  • Are these cookies gluten-free?

While the recipe doesn’t contain flour, always check your peanut butter label to ensure it’s gluten-free if you have dietary restrictions.

  • Can I reduce the sugar in the recipe?

You can slightly reduce sugar, but it might change the cookie’s texture and spreading. For best results, stick close to the original recipe.

Ingredients

Scale

Main Ingredients:

  • 1 cup (240 ml) peanut butter
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 cup (200 g) granulated sugar

Binding and Flavoring Ingredients:

  • 1 teaspoon (5 ml) vanilla extract

Leavening and Seasoning Ingredients:

  • 1/2 teaspoon (2.5 ml) baking soda
  • 1/4 teaspoon (1.25 ml) salt

Instructions

  1. Prepare the workspace by warming the oven to 350F (175C) and lining a baking sheet with parchment paper for optimal cookie performance.
  2. Create a smooth, uniform mixture by thoroughly blending peanut butter, sugar, egg, vanilla extract, baking soda, and salt in a mixing bowl until ingredients are fully integrated.
  3. Shape the dough into compact, uniform 1-inch spheres, strategically positioning them on the prepared baking sheet with sufficient spacing.
  4. Gently press each dough ball using fork tines, generating a distinctive crisscross texture that enhances visual appeal and ensures even baking.
  5. Position the baking sheet in the preheated oven and monitor cookies for 8-10 minutes, watching for set edges and slightly soft centers, which indicate perfect doneness.
  6. Allow cookies to rest on the baking sheet for 5 minutes, enabling them to stabilize and prevent breakage during transfer.
  7. Carefully relocate cookies to a wire cooling rack, permitting complete cooling and texture refinement before serving or storing.

Notes

  • Ensure peanut butter is at room temperature for smoother mixing and better dough consistency.
  • Use creamy peanut butter for a more uniform texture, or try crunchy for added nutty crunch.
  • For gluten-free option, confirm all ingredients, especially baking soda, are certified gluten-free.
  • Reduce sugar by 25% for a less sweet version that highlights the natural peanut butter flavor.
